Crusade returns for another year with a drop in price point, but that does not necessary make it a better value. The 250-card base set comprises of 150 veterans, 50 rookies and 50 legends. The rookies and legends appear 1:3 packs. There are three numbered parallels for the base cards.
A little confusing, there is also a Crusade Insert set. You will get more Crusade inserts in a box than base cards. Each pack yielded three Crusade inserts with 1-2 base cards. Base cards are showcased on a white card stock while the parallels are refractor based. The refractors have many versions from the unnumbered blue to a Green /5. All total, there are eight levels.
Only three insert sets grace Crusade. While this box contained two, odds are you could get less than that with Nobility (1:14), Royalty and Night Court (1:18 each). There are lackluster in nature as they seem like simple carryovers from the base card design with little tweaks. There are no parallel versions of any of these.
Each box should yield one autograph and one relic on average. The two relic series are Quest and Majestic Memorabilia, both with a Prime version /25. Autographs get a better treatment with a small array of sets. Rookies get some love with Apprentice Signatures. Legends appear in Hardwood Homage and Sultans of Springfield. Other sets include Quest, Majestic and High Praise Ink. The bright side is the use of on card autographs in some cases.
